位置:51电子网 » 技术资料 » 接口电路

USB固件程序的设计

发布时间:2008/12/26 0:00:00 访问次数:528

  结合usb1,1协议和usb接口芯片的特性设计固件程序。固件程序主要是对arm中的usb接口设备进行配置和usb数据传输的读写操作。

  其中,usb设备配置包括设备描述符、配置描述符、接口描述符、端点描述符和字符串描述符(可选)等,配置过程在usb设备插入pc时完成。在此程序设计中,通过控制端点0和pc交换信息来配置usb从设备;然后,通过usb读写端点2来传输数据。整个固件程序的流程如图所示。

  图 usb固件程序流程图

  欢迎转载,信息来自维库电子市场网(www.dzsc.com)



  结合usb1,1协议和usb接口芯片的特性设计固件程序。固件程序主要是对arm中的usb接口设备进行配置和usb数据传输的读写操作。

  其中,usb设备配置包括设备描述符、配置描述符、接口描述符、端点描述符和字符串描述符(可选)等,配置过程在usb设备插入pc时完成。在此程序设计中,通过控制端点0和pc交换信息来配置usb从设备;然后,通过usb读写端点2来传输数据。整个固件程序的流程如图所示。

  图 usb固件程序流程图

  欢迎转载,信息来自维库电子市场网(www.dzsc.com)



上一篇:驱动程序设计

上一篇:USB硬件原理图

相关IC型号

热门点击

 

推荐技术资料

耳机放大器
    为了在听音乐时不影响家人,我萌生了做一台耳机放大器的想... [详细]
版权所有:51dzw.COM
深圳服务热线:13751165337  13692101218
粤ICP备09112631号-6(miitbeian.gov.cn)
公网安备44030402000607
深圳市碧威特网络技术有限公司
付款方式


 复制成功!